mirror of
https://github.com/CISOfy/lynis.git
synced 2025-07-28 08:14:10 +02:00
Replace awk statement with grep to simplify search
This commit is contained in:
parent
ab9a53169b
commit
e0b93ed0cc
@ -515,7 +515,8 @@
|
|||||||
if [ ! -z "${OS_VERSION}" ]; then
|
if [ ! -z "${OS_VERSION}" ]; then
|
||||||
if [ -f "${DBDIR}/software-eol.db" ]; then
|
if [ -f "${DBDIR}/software-eol.db" ]; then
|
||||||
FIND="${OS_FULLNAME}"
|
FIND="${OS_FULLNAME}"
|
||||||
EOL_DATE=$(awk -v value="${FIND}" -F: '{if ($1=="os" && $2 ~ value){print $3}}' ${DBDIR}/software-eol.db | head -n 1)
|
# Does not work on FreeBSD: EOL_DATE=$(awk -v value="${FIND}" -F: '{if ($1=="os" && $2 ~ value){print $3}}' ${DBDIR}/software-eol.db | head -n 1)
|
||||||
|
EOL_DATE=$(grep "os:${FIND}" ${DBDIR}/software-eol.db | awk -F: '{print $3}' | head -n 1)
|
||||||
if [ ! -z "${EOL_DATE}" ]; then
|
if [ ! -z "${EOL_DATE}" ]; then
|
||||||
NOW=$(date "+%s")
|
NOW=$(date "+%s")
|
||||||
FIND=$(date "+%s" --date=${EOL_DATE})
|
FIND=$(date "+%s" --date=${EOL_DATE})
|
||||||
|
Loading…
x
Reference in New Issue
Block a user